Watch a detailed restoration video demonstrating the process of creating and installing a new one-piece babbitt bearing for a vintage blacksmith blower. Learn step-by-step techniques for machining, pouring, and fitting babbitt bearings as part of machinery restoration work. Follow along as traditional metalworking methods are used to fabricate this critical component that allows the blower's shaft to rotate smoothly. The video provides hands-on instruction in bearing making, offering valuable insights for those interested in vintage machinery repair and maintenance.
